88.86 percent of the population in 04092 drive to work alone. 0.09 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 80.80 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 3.76 percent of the residents in 04092 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.12 members with about 2.07 cars available per household.
An estimate of 97.07 percent of the residents in 04092 has some form of health insurance. 34.82 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 74.74 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 04092 would have to travel an average of 2.42 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Spring Harbor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 04092, Westbrook, Maine.

As of , an estimate of 20,074 residents live in 04092 with a median age of 37.7 years. 16.91 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 18.32 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 41.31 percent of the residents in 04092 is currently married, and 22.03 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 04092 is $6,965.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 04092 is approximately $1,226. The median household spends about 17.60 percent of their income on housing.
